Online Class Availability at Delta State University
Online coursework is an option at Delta State University. Of 2,654 students, 932 (35%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 1,213 (46%) took at least some classes online.
Median Debt at Graduation
Median student loan debt for Criminal Justice & Corrections graduates from Delta State University comes in at $25,896.
Student Demographics & Diversity
The following sections describe the diversity of Criminal Justice & Corrections graduates at Delta State University, broken down by degree level.
Program-wide, Criminal Justice & Corrections graduates at Delta State University are 69% women (11) and 31% men (5).
Criminal Justice & Corrections Bachelor’s Program at Delta State University
Among the 6 bachelor’s criminal justice & corrections graduates at Delta State University, 50% were women (3) and 50% were men (3).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Criminal Justice & Corrections bachelor’s degree recipients at Delta State University.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 2 |
| Black / African American | 3 |
| International (Nonresident) | 1 |
Racial-ethnic minorities make up 50% of Criminal Justice & Corrections bachelor’s degree recipients at Delta State University, below the national average of 52%.*
Criminal Justice & Corrections Master’s Program at Delta State University
Of the 10 master’s criminal justice & corrections degrees awarded at Delta State University, 80% were women (8) and 20% were men (2).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Criminal Justice & Corrections master’s degree recipients at Delta State University.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 3 |
| Black / African American | 7 |
Racial-ethnic minorities make up 70% of Criminal Justice & Corrections master’s degree recipients at Delta State University, above the national average of 47%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
